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2011.11.13;
Скачать: CL | DM;

Вниз

MSSQL и поле типа TEXT   Найти похожие ветки 

 
GEN001 ©   (2010-02-15 21:12) [0]

Имеется MSSQL 2000 и таблица с полем DCS типа TEXT. Использую Delphi+ADO.
Добавляю в таблицу новую запись при помощи insert into c параметрами.
Если строка, записываемая в поле DCS имеет длину примерно до 800 символов, то запись добавляется с заполненным полем DCS. Если строка длиннее 800 символов то сама запись добавляется, НО поле DOCS с типом TEXT остается пустым. В чем причина?
Заранее спасибо за помощь!


 
sniknik ©   (2010-02-15 21:54) [1]

> В чем причина?
17я строка. вне сомнений.


 
12 ©   (2010-02-16 14:22) [2]

может, ограничения какие на поле стоят/ триггер
у меня 2000 знаков с лишним - полет нормальный


 
ANB   (2010-02-16 15:03) [3]


> GEN001 ©   (15.02.10 21:12)

Надо посмотреть общую длинну записи и триггера, есно.


 
Ega23 ©   (2010-02-16 15:03) [4]


> может, ограничения какие на поле стоят/ триггер
> у меня 2000 знаков с лишним - полет нормальный


Сомневаюсь. Скорее на параметре ограничения.


 
GEN001 ©   (2010-02-16 18:51) [5]


> Скорее на параметре ограничения.

Где и как это посмотреть?

P.S. в другом месте мне сказали что в поле с типом TEXT нельзя записывать текст, в котором больше 16 строк, но удаление символов перевода строки (#10, #13) лишь частично решило проблему - некоторые записи так и добавляются пустыми.


 
GEN001 ©   (2010-02-16 19:32) [6]


> в другом месте мне сказали

прошу прощения за этот кусок своей фразы :) остальная часть фразы правильная :)


 
Ega23 ©   (2010-02-16 20:31) [7]


> в другом месте мне сказали что в поле с типом TEXT нельзя
> записывать текст, в котором больше 16 строк


Плюнь в тех людей слюной и скажи им, что они полные нюбы.

З.Ы. только что прикола ради зафигачил в параметр текст на 28 кб. Всё вставилось.


 
GEN001 ©   (2010-02-16 22:19) [8]

Дело в том, что я пытаюсь загружать текст, полученный из старого FLINT. Кодировку DOS я победил, но может там остались какие-то спец-символы, которые не возможно записать в поле с типом TEXT ?


 
Плохиш ©   (2010-02-17 00:21) [9]

Не люблю партизан.


 
Ega23 ©   (2010-02-17 00:37) [10]

Мы уже кода дождёмся, или где?


 
sniknik ©   (2010-02-17 07:42) [11]

> но может там остались какие-то спец-символы, которые не возможно записать в поле с типом TEXT ?
#0



Страницы: 1 вся ветка

Текущий архив: 2011.11.13;
Скачать: CL | DM;

Наверх




Память: 0.49 MB
Время: 0.01 c
2-1311265628
Tim
2011-07-21 20:27
2011.11.13
вывод real числа в dbgrid


2-1311205811
alexdn
2011-07-21 03:50
2011.11.13
Считывать построчно тхт


15-1310569650
R_R
2011-07-13 19:07
2011.11.13
PHP, Как составить список подключенных сокетов?


1-1272350903
Юрий Зотов
2010-04-27 10:48
2011.11.13
Ошибка создания формы в design-time


2-1311114807
alexdn
2011-07-20 02:33
2011.11.13
Снять координаты курсора